New Orleans Saints predraft depth chart: Safety
1 Attachment(s)
The New Orleans Saints boast a highly capable quartet of safeties on the roster despite personnel turnover during free agency.
Rafael Bush signed with the Buffalo Bills, while Kenny Vaccaro wasn’t brought back. Nevertheless, the Saints are more than fine with returning players in the form of Vonn Bell, Marcus Williams and special teams ace Chris Banjo. The Saints also signed proven veteran Kurt Coleman to a three-year deal to help offset the losses of Bush and Vaccaro, and signed former LSU standout Rickey Jefferson to a reserve/future contract. With Williams and Bell locked in on rookie contracts, the Saints don’t have an immediate need in the early rounds of the draft. But adding a player would be wise when considering the team only has five safeties currently on the roster ahead of organized team activities (OTAs) and training camp.
